> When I am trying to overlay the CAI:EventParams form and trying to overlay
> one particular field (ParamValue) for its input length, The devloper Studio
> gives error:
>
>
>
> *The granular overlay masks contain invalid or conflicting values. :
> CAI:EvnetParams : <extend 0, inherit 1>.*
>
>
>
> Do we have any devstudio experts here who can suggest here. ? DO they
> supposed to do in Base Dev mode only ?
>
> If at all we want to do this, what could be the best approach of doing it ?
>
>
>
> ARS: 8.1 SP1
>
> DevStudio: 8.1 SP1
